Naira appreciates by 0.71%, exchanges at 418.50 to dollar

The Naira returned stronger as it appreciated by 0.71 per cent against the dollar at the Investors and Exporters window on Tuesday.

The Naira exchanged at N418.50 to the dollar, compared with the N421.50 it traded on Monday.

The open indicative rate closed at N417.42 to the dollar on Tuesday.

An exchange rate of N444.00 to the dollar was the highest rate recorded within the day’s trading before it settled at N418.50.

The Naira sold for as low as 410 to the dollar within the day’s trading.

A total of 105.11 million dollars was traded in foreign exchange at the official Investors and Exporters window on Tuesday.
